People applying for income protection from Cirencester Friendly can now arrange for a nurse to visit them at home in order to assess their health, rather than visiting their GP. The nurse from Medicals Direct will carry out a range of tests including measuring blood pressure, the results of which will be immediately available to Cirencester Friendly, which will then process the application.
Paul Hudson of Cirencester Friendly says, "Waiting for GPs to provide us with information and test results are two of the biggest causes of hold-ups in our application process. By offering nurse screenings and working with Medicals Direct to obtain GP reports we hope to reduce our application turnaround times."
